Data Snapshot: ZIP 22801 (Harrisonburg, VA)

Homeowners in ZIP 22801 (Harrisonburg, VA) pay an average of $947 per year for insurance as of 2022, according to U.S. Treasury FIO ZIP-level data across approximately 451 reported policies. That is 47% below the national average of $1,776 per year, placing this ZIP in the 4th percentile nationally. Against Virginia's average of $1,369, ZIP 22801 is 31% below, ranking #707 of 748 tracked ZIPs in Virginia by premium. The closest-priced peer within Virginia is Collinsville (ZIP 24078) at $947, essentially matching this ZIP's rate.

ZIP 22801 shows a 19.0% loss ratio, an indication that insurers retained a working margin after claims. Claim frequency, the share of policies with at least one claim, is 1.92%, and the average claim severity (amount paid per claim) is $9,383. The nonrenewal rate here is 0.74%, a rise of 17.0% over the past five years, the share of policies insurers choose not to extend at expiration, often a leading sign of market stress.

Across 5 years (2018–2022), premiums in ZIP 22801 have risen by 6.9%, ranging from $886 to $947 with a five-year average of $922, an annualized rate of +1.7% per year.

How to read these numbers

The figures on this page come from the U.S. Treasury Federal Insurance Office, which collects homeowners insurance premium and claims data directly from the largest property insurers in the country. Because the data is aggregated at the ZIP-code level and averaged across many policies, it describes the typical cost in an area rather than a quote for any single home. Two houses on the same street can pay very different premiums depending on their age, construction type, roof condition, prior claims, and the specific coverage limits and deductibles the homeowner selects. The loss ratio shows how much of every premium dollar insurers paid back out as claims; a ratio above one means carriers lost money locally, which often precedes rate increases or carrier exits. Rising nonrenewal and claim frequency reveal how stressed the local market has become. Use these figures to gauge the direction and scale of costs in your area, then request quotes from several licensed carriers before buying or renewing a policy. FIO data aggregates voluntary reporting from the 40 largest homeowners insurers, covering roughly 80% of the U.S. market, so figures represent market averages rather than individual policy quotes; your own premium will vary with dwelling value, deductible, coverage limits, construction type, and insurer-specific underwriting.
